Description

Antique 18th century George III mahogany inlaid tea/side table having a quality mahogany lift up top crossbanded in satinwood which opens to reveal a polished figured mahogany inside crossbanded in satinwood, mahogany frieze also crossbanded in satinwood and supported by square tapering reeded shaped legs, the back two legs swing open to support the top.

A handsome example of this period having lovely colour and patina.

H 78cm

W 89.5cm

D 44.5cm

All pieces shipped internationally are supplied with an official Antique Declaration for customs purposes. Antiques over 100 years old are exempt from import duty when entering the USA and generally attract a reduced rate of duty when imported from the UK into most European countries.

George III tea tables, produced in Britain during the mid-to-late 18th century, are defined by classical symmetry, straight line profiles, and refined proportions. Common characteristics include square tapered legs, subtle string inlay, flame mahogany veneers, and fold-over tops designed for versatility.

Craftsmen of this period primarily utilised solid Cuban or West Indian mahogany for structural stability, alongside satinwood or boxwood for decorative inlay and stringing. Secondary internal woods typically included oak or pine for drawer linings and support framing.

Authentic period pieces display hand-sawn timber marks, hand-cut dovetail joints, brass fold-over hinges, and natural timber shrinkage across wide panel surfaces. Original patination shows uneven colouration from age and exposure rather than uniform modern finishes.

A Georgian fold-over table serves as a functional console in an entryway, behind a sofa, or within a formal living area. Its slender depth permits placement in narrow hallways while offering expanded surface space when unfolded.

Preserve mahogany surfaces by dusting with a dry microfiber cloth and applying beeswax polish once or twice per year. Maintain consistent indoor humidity levels and position the item away from direct heat sources and natural sunlight to prevent timber movement and fading.
